Data Architect
West Monroe is a global business and technology consulting firm passionate about creating measurable value for clients. As a Data Architect, you will lead the design and implementation of data solutions, mentor teams, and shape data strategies to enable data-driven decision-making.

Responsibilities
Strategic Leadership: Collaborate with senior leadership and stakeholders to define data strategies and roadmaps aligned with business objectives
Solution Design: Architect robust, scalable, and secure data solutions, including data pipelines, warehouses, lakes, and analytics platforms
Data Governance: Establish and enforce data governance frameworks, ensuring data quality, security, and compliance with industry standards and regulations
Team Leadership: Mentor and guide junior engineers, fostering a culture of continuous learning and innovation. Lead technical teams in delivering high-quality projects on time and within scope
Technology Evaluation: Stay ahead of emerging technologies and trends, evaluating and recommending tools, platforms, and frameworks to enhance data capabilities
Cross-Functional Collaboration: Work closely with business analysts, data scientists, and software engineers to integrate data solutions into broader business applications
Performance Optimization: Continuously monitor and optimize data systems for performance, scalability, and cost efficiency
Client Engagement: Act as a trusted advisor to clients, providing thought leadership and technical expertise in solving complex data challenges
Documentation: Create and maintain technical documentation, including architecture diagrams, data models, and operational procedures
Incident Management: Lead troubleshooting efforts for critical data issues, ensuring timely resolution and root cause analysis
Innovation: Drive innovation by identifying opportunities to leverage AI, machine learning, and advanced analytics in data engineering solutions
Qualification
Required
Bachelor's or Master's degree in Computer Science, Data Engineering, Information Systems, or a related field
Minimum of 10 years of experience in data engineering or architecture, with at least 3 years in a leadership role
Proven track record of architecting and delivering large-scale data solutions in cloud environments (e.g., AWS, Azure, GCP)
Expertise in data modeling, ETL processes, and data pipeline development
Extensive experience with modern data platforms: Databricks and/or Snowflake preferred
Experience with data modeling and engineering in Databricks, including Delta Lake and advanced Spark-based transformations
Expertise in data modeling with Snowflake, including schema design, performance optimization, and leveraging Snowflake's unique capabilities (e.g., time travel, zero-copy cloning)
Proficiency in programming languages such as Python, SQL, Java, or Scala
Experience with big data technologies (e.g., Hadoop, Spark, Kafka)
Hands-on experience with cloud-native data services (e.g., AWS Redshift, Azure Synapse, Google BigQuery)
Strong understanding of database technologies (e.g., relational, NoSQL, graph databases)
Familiarity with containerization and orchestration tools (e.g., Docker, Kubernetes)
Exceptional ability to lead and mentor technical teams
Strong communication and interpersonal skills to collaborate with diverse stakeholders
Demonstrated ability to manage competing priorities and deliver results under pressure
Advanced analytical skills to solve complex technical and business problems
Ability to translate technical concepts into business value for non-technical stakeholders
Strong organizational and project management skills
Preferred
Preferred certifications such as AWS Certified Data Analytics, Azure Data Engineer Associate, or Google Professional Data Engineer
